【问题标题】:How to create a NuGet package using .csproj and external references?如何使用 .csproj 和外部引用创建 NuGet 包?
【发布时间】:2015-04-22 15:54:31
【问题描述】:

我的目的不仅是使用 Nuget 存储库构建 .Net 代码,而且是实现一个 CI 流程,我们将从 Nexus Nuget Group 存储库下载 Nuget 包。 SVN 作为软件版本控制和修订控制系统,Jenkins 作为 CI 工具。 现在我的目的是使用 Nexus 存储库下载 nuget 包,使用 SVN 下载代码并使用 Jenkins 使用 MSbuild 构建代码。 根据我的理解,您要求我从 Visual Studio 下载包,然后将包括二进制文件在内的整个代码上传到 SVN 中,这不是我想要的。 另外,我想将构建的输出上传回 Nexus,以便可以通过子引用(如果有)来获取。 在这种情况下,如何将 nuget 存储库与 Visual Studio 一起使用? 你能提出任何相同的步骤吗?

【问题讨论】:

    标签: svn jenkins nuget


    【解决方案1】:

    如何使用 .csproj 和外部引用创建 NuGet 包?

    试试我在这里发布的解决方案:articleVisual Studio extensionproject site

    它将使您能够从一个或多个项目创建 NuGet 包,包括定义对其他 NuGet 的依赖项(在解决方案外部并在同一构建中创建)。

    【讨论】:

    • @OndrejSotolar 我修复了链接并添加了两个。
    猜你喜欢
    • 1970-01-01
    • 2015-10-13
    • 1970-01-01
    • 2017-12-29
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2011-10-12
    • 1970-01-01
    相关资源
    最近更新 更多